Can You Really Lose Weight Without Counting Calories?



Yes, it’s possible, you can lose weight without tracking every calorie. At its core, weight loss is about managing what you eat, and there are more intuitive approaches to manage your food consumption without being so meticulous with numbers.



Below are some proven methods to achieve weight loss without needing to count every calorie:



Prioritize Nutrient-Dense Foods



Focusing on nutrient-dense foods can be a highly effective way to shed pounds without needing to track every bite. Whole foods are naturally filling and help you stay full for longer, making it easier to maintain a calorie deficit without having to measure everything.





The best nutrient-dense options include:




  • Fruits and vegetables: Packed with fiber, fruits and vegetables help you feel full without adding excess calories to your diet.

  • Lean proteins: Lean meats and plant-based proteins help preserve muscle and promote satiety, making them essential for weight management.

  • Whole grains: Opt for whole grains provides sustained energy and supports healthy digestion without the need for calorie counting.

  • Healthy fats: Incorporate fats from sources like avocados, nuts, and olive oil support weight loss by keeping you full for longer periods.



Manage Your Portions Without Counting Calories



One of the simplest ways to shed pounds without tracking every bite is practicing portion control. By eating smaller portions, you limit your caloric intake without the need to track. Here are some easy strategies to get started:




  • Use smaller plates: This simple trick can help you naturally eat less, as it gives the illusion of a fuller plate.

  • Eat slowly: Slowing down when you eat gives your body time to send signals of satiety, which helps prevent overeating.

  • Stop eating when satisfied: Instead of eating until you're stuffed, stop eating when you feel comfortably full to help maintain a calorie deficit without tracking.



Eat Mindfully



Eating mindfully is an effective way to lose weight without counting calories because it helps you become aware of the food you consume and how much you’re eating. This is how you can practice mindful eating:




  • Eat without distractions: Eating while distracted, you are more likely to overeat. Focus on your food, and you’ll eat more consciously.

  • Chew your food thoroughly: Taking your time to chew helps with digestion and gives your body time to signal fullness, reducing the chances of overeating.



Stay Hydrated



Drinking plenty of water is crucial for weight loss without calorie tracking. Hydration plays a key role in hunger control and can reduce unnecessary snacking. Here’s how you can use water to support weight loss:




  • Drink water before meals: Drinking water before a meal can help you feel full, helping to reduce calorie intake without tracking.

  • Replace sugary drinks with water: Sugary beverages are high in calories to your diet, so switching to water can help cut calories without any counting.



Get Enough Sleep



Getting enough rest is frequently ignored but plays a big role in losing weight. Lack of sleep disrupts hunger hormones, leading to overeating.





Try to get 7-9 hours of sleep each night to aid in weight loss without calorie counting.
